Merge pull request #15 from donghoon-song/gitlocalize-14698
7-bank-project/4-state-management/translations/assignment.ko.mdpull/101/head
commit
10095b95fe
@ -0,0 +1,24 @@
|
|||||||
|
# "거래 추가" 대화 상자 구현
|
||||||
|
|
||||||
|
## 설명
|
||||||
|
|
||||||
|
우리 은행 앱에는 여전히 새로운 거래를 입력 할 수 있는 한 가지 중요한 기능이 없습니다. 이전 네 가지 수업에서 배운 모든 것을 사용하여 "트랜잭션 추가" 대화 상자를 구현해봅시다.
|
||||||
|
|
||||||
|
- 대시 보드 페이지에 "거래 추가" 버튼 추가
|
||||||
|
- HTML 템플릿으로 새 페이지를 만들거나 JavaScript를 사용하여 대시 보드 페이지를 벗어나지 않고 대화 상자 HTML을 표시하거나 숨깁니다(해당 항목에 대해 [`hidden`](https://developer.mozilla.org/en-US/docs/Web/HTML/Global_attributes/hidden) 속성 또는 CSS 클래스를 사용할 수 있음).
|
||||||
|
- 대화 상자에 대한 [키보드 및 화면 판독기 접근성](https://developer.paciellogroup.com/blog/2018/06/the-current-state-of-modal-dialog-accessibility/)을 처리해야합니다.
|
||||||
|
- 입력 데이터 수신을 위한 HTML 양식 구현
|
||||||
|
- 양식 데이터에서 JSON 데이터를 만들어 API로 보냅니다.
|
||||||
|
- 새 데이터로 대시 보드 페이지 업데이트
|
||||||
|
|
||||||
|
호출해야하는 API와 예상되는 JSON 형식을 확인하려면 [서버 API 사양](../api/README.md) 을 살펴보세요.
|
||||||
|
|
||||||
|
다음은 과제를 완료 한 후의 예시 결과입니다.
|
||||||
|
|
||||||
|
![예시를 보여주는 스크린샷 이미지](./images/dialog.png)
|
||||||
|
|
||||||
|
## 평가 기준
|
||||||
|
|
||||||
|
기준 | 모범 답안 | 적당한 답안 | 개선이 필요한 답안
|
||||||
|
--- | --- | --- | ---
|
||||||
|
| 거래 추가 기능이 수업에서 본 모든 모범 사례에 따라 완전히 구현된 경우 | 거래 추가기능은 구현되지만, 강의에 표시된 모범 사례를 따르지 않거나 부분적으로만 작동하는 경우 | 거래 추가기능이 전혀 동작하지 않는 경우
|
Loading…
Reference in new issue